Hex
#E0BE62
LRV
54.00
Lemon Surprise's Color Strip
Lemon Surprise is the sixth shade on this 7-color strip, sitting between Golden Glow and Sin City. The strip spans from Annabel at the lightest end to Sin City at the deepest. Strip 71 lines up the full value range so you can see exactly where this color lands among its closest relatives.
